新聞中心
Linux系統(tǒng)使用systemd工具排查啟動慢的原因

1. 查看系統(tǒng)啟動時間
我們可以使用systemdanalyze命令來查看系統(tǒng)的啟動時間,這將幫助我們了解系統(tǒng)啟動過程中各個服務(wù)的啟動時間,從而找出可能導(dǎo)致啟動慢的服務(wù)。
systemdanalyze time
2. 分析啟動過程
我們可以使用systemdanalyze criticalchain命令來查看系統(tǒng)啟動過程中的關(guān)鍵鏈,這將顯示啟動過程中的依賴關(guān)系,幫助我們找出可能導(dǎo)致啟動慢的服務(wù)。
systemdanalyze criticalchain
3. 查看各個服務(wù)的啟動時間
我們可以使用systemdanalyze blame命令來查看系統(tǒng)啟動過程中各個服務(wù)的啟動時間,這將幫助我們找出啟動時間較長的服務(wù),從而找出可能導(dǎo)致啟動慢的服務(wù)。
systemdanalyze blame
4. 查看啟動日志
我們可以使用journalctl命令來查看系統(tǒng)啟動過程中的日志,這將幫助我們找出可能導(dǎo)致啟動慢的服務(wù)或錯誤。
journalctl b 0
5. 優(yōu)化啟動過程
根據(jù)上述步驟找出的問題,我們可以采取相應(yīng)的措施來優(yōu)化啟動過程,禁用不必要的服務(wù)、調(diào)整服務(wù)的啟動順序等。
禁用服務(wù) systemctl disable啟用服務(wù) systemctl enable 調(diào)整服務(wù)的啟動順序 systemctl edit
6. 重啟系統(tǒng)并觀察效果
完成優(yōu)化后,我們需要重啟系統(tǒng)并再次使用systemdanalyze命令來觀察優(yōu)化效果,如果啟動時間有所減少,說明我們的優(yōu)化措施是有效的。
reboot
通過以上步驟,我們可以使用systemd工具排查Linux系統(tǒng)啟動慢的原因,并采取相應(yīng)的措施進行優(yōu)化。
當前文章:linux應(yīng)用啟動慢
轉(zhuǎn)載來源:http://www.dlmjj.cn/article/cohcjje.html


咨詢
建站咨詢
